1 Objects of Zone:
-To provide a wide range of industrial and warehouse land uses
-To encourage employment opportunities
-To minimise any adverse effect of industry on other land uses
-To support and protect industrial land of industrial uses
2 Permitted without consent:
Home occupations; Roads
3 Permitted with consent:
Animal boarding and training establishments; Depots; Freight transport facilities; General industries; Industrial training facilities; Light industries; Neighbourhood shops; Warehouse or distribution centres; Any other development not specified in item 2 or 4
4 Prohibited:
Agriculture; Airstrips; Bulky goods premises; Business premises; Camping grounds; Caravan parks; Cellar door premises; Eco-tourist facilities; Entertainment facilities; Exhibition homes; Exhibition villages; Farm buildings; Food and drink premises; Forestry; Function centres; Funeral homes; Heavy industries; Marinas; Markets; Mooring pens; Moorings; Office premises; Recreation facilities (outdoor); Registered clubs; Residential accommodation; Roadside stalls; Shops; Stock and sale yards; Tourist and visitor accommodation.

The size of Dungog is approximately 5.5 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 4.5% of total area. The population of Dungog in 2016 was 2025 people. By 2021 the population was 1983 showing a population decline of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dungog is 60-69 years. Households in Dungog are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dungog work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 72.60% of the homes in Dungog were owner-occupied compared with 71.30% in 2016.
